Video footage captures robbers stealing a man’s $35,000 watch in Chelsea while the victim futilely tries to run away, cops say.
The creeps approached the 55-year-old victim around 10 p.m. Aug. 29 at 235 Ninth Ave., with one of the suspects lifting his shirt and acting as if he had a gun in his waistband, police said.
“What’s up with the watch?” the robber asked of the victim’s Cartier timepiece, according to police.

It was unclear if the suspect actually had a gun, police said.
The victim ran to the intersection of West 24th Street and Ninth Avenue to try to flee, but the robbers chased him, and a second suspect yanked the watch off the victim’s left wrist.

The suspects then fled in a black sedan that was last seen traveling southbound on Ninth Avenue. The victim did not suffer any injuries.
